METHOD OF FORMING AN INTRODUCER SHEATH
First Claim
1. A method of forming an introducer sheath having a tapered distal tip portion, comprising:
- providing a mandrel having an outer configuration comprising an elongated body and a tapered distal tip;
positioning a generally tubular inner liner over the mandrel, said inner liner comprising a heat shrinkable fluoropolymer;
heat shrinking the inner liner over the mandrel such that said inner liner shrinks to the outer configuration of the mandrel, a distal portion of the inner liner shrinking to the configuration of the mandrel tapered distal tip and having an inner diameter substantially free of creases therealong;
positioning a reinforcing member over a length of the inner liner;
positioning an outer jacket over the reinforcing member and the inner liner; and
heating an assembly comprising said inner liner, reinforcing member, and outer jacket, such that said outer jacket bonds to an outer surface of said inner liner.

Abstract
A method of forming an introducer sheath having a crease-free tapered distal tip portion. A mandrel is provided having an outer configuration comprising an elongated body and a tapered distal tip portion. A generally tubular inner liner comprising heat shrinkable PTFE, is positioned over the mandrel. The inner liner is heat shrunk to the outer configuration of the mandrel, in a manner that avoids the formation of creases along the inner diameter of the liner. A reinforcing member is positioned over a length of the inner liner, and an outer jacket is positioned over the reinforcing member and the inner liner. The liner, reinforcing member, and outer jacket are heated in a heat shrink enclosure, whereby the outer jacket melts and bonds to an outer surface of the inner liner.

9. A method of forming an introducer sheath, comprising:
-
providing a mandrel comprising an elongated body and a tapered distal tip portion; heat shrinking a polymeric tubular liner to the outer configuration of the mandrel, said liner having a first melt temperature; and heat shrinking an outer jacket over the liner such that the outer jacket bonds to an outer surface of the liner, said outer jacket having a second melt temperature, the second melt temperature being less than the first melt temperature. - View Dependent Claims (10, 11, 12, 13, 14, 15)

16. An introducer sheath, comprising:
-
an inner liner having a proximal end and a distal end, said inner liner having an inner diameter and an outer diameter, said inner and outer diameters tapering to a distal tip portion of said inner liner, said inner diameter taper being free of creases therealong; a reinforcing member positioned over said inner liner; and an outer jacket having a proximal end and a distal end, said outer jacket having an inner diameter and an outer diameter, said inner and outer diameters tapering to a distal tip portion of said outer jacket, said outer jacket positioned longitudinally around said reinforcing member and said inner liner, and bonded to said outer diameter of said inner liner. - View Dependent Claims (17, 18, 19, 20)
